Thailand: Manufacturing output drops for 11th-consecutive month in March
Manufacturing output fell 11.3% year-on-year in March, down from the 5.2% contraction in the prior month and marking the 11th consecutive month of shrinking production. March’s figure was underpinned by drops in automotive; petroleum refining products; basic iron and steel; food; rubber and plastic; and apparel production. Annual average production contracted 5.0% in March, down from February’s 4.3% fall.
Meanwhile, manufacturing production rose 1.9% month-on-month in March, swinging from the 1.4% drop recorded in February.
